The runtime memory required by Xpect (M

RUNTIME

) must not exceed 75% of the total amount of memory

available. Xpect applies this restriction to ensure the system does not become unusable due to

resource starvation.
The memory usage estimate for HD AVC Mosaic service is less accurate compare to a SD service,

so make sure to have sufficient free Memory available.

2.3 Xpect server: required hard disk space

Like the memory usage, the required hard disk space depends on a number of variables such as the

number of transport streams, pre- and post-trigger buffer sizes and the maximum number of entries

to be stored in the log database.
The required disk space can be computed using the formulae below (all values in MB):
